logo

Output 58ce18f17429c63ae4de6b7b294cd63891860b0bc77b9bbcb882296d2e3687e4:20

value
15911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f60cf187632453f6e9fa1c8ad69fb888da7c43 OP_EQUAL
address
3JZ11jUk3YMjKE75sq9CjWH6DzmbFUEhrh
transaction
58ce18f17429c63ae4de6b7b294cd63891860b0bc77b9bbcb882296d2e3687e4